Why This Must Be Read: When this ficlet begins, you're thrown into a universe as dark and dangerous as the Mos Eisley Cantina. In fact, it begins in a bar, where an unsavory low-life named Gej is contemplating his chances with various women that night. That is, until he sees Solo's girl, all dolled up and looking for a good time--a time which Gej feels uniquely qualified to provide, especially if it means getting revenge on Solo. Things aren't quite what they appear, though, and Gej may have landed himself in more trouble than he can manage when Solo himself shows up.
This fic does a great job of showing a different side to Leia and Han, playing with the "what if?" concept of the AU and yet keeping both of them firmly in-character. The setting is gritty and the sensory description fabulous, and the ending is funny and fun.
